Changes in 20210219094547

Built from f2cb3ed27e689f45cea83bdd6bfc490c21ef74e1

..index..
Bug 1691069 R[Core:Canvas: WebGL]Perma Android TEST-UNEXPECTED-PASS | /webrtc/RTCPeerConnection-relay-canvas.https.html | Two PeerConnections relaying a canvas source - expected TIMEOUT
Bug 1693176 A[Core:DOM: Animation]CSS animations in hidden panels cause the refresh driver to keep ticking
Bug 902346 R[Core:DOM: Core & HTML]mozTCPSocket should respect the proxy preferences
Bug 1691595 R[Core:DOM: Navigation]Move evictAllContentViewers test code to SpecialPowers
Bug 1693194 R[Core:DOM: UI Events & Focus Handling]Split wpt pointerevent_attributes_hoverable_pointers.html
Bug 1648813 N[Core:Disability Access APIs]Intermittent accessible/tests/browser/mac/browser_webarea.js | Test timed out -
Bug 1693447 R[Core:Graphics: WebRender]Fix rectangle clips being ignored in some cases in wrench.
Bug 1688096 A[Core:Graphics: WebRender]Use Software WebRender for popups when using Hardware Webrender on Windows
Bug 1693347 R[Core:IPC]Avoid including GeckoProfiler.h when it's not going to be used
Bug 1693328 R[Core:JavaScript Engine]Sparse array in spread causes assertion violation in Spidermonkey
Bug 1693062 R[Core:JavaScript Engine: JIT]Differential output with Math functions and Ion
Bug 1692833 R[Core:JavaScript Engine: JIT]Crash [@ js::jit::RInstructionResults::operator[]] with Debugger
Bug 1670055 R[Core:JavaScript: Internationalization API]Legacy Intl object detection should use OrdinaryHasInstance semantics, not instanceof semantics
Bug 1674302 R[Core:Layout: Flexbox][css-flexbox] Wrong Size/MinSize/MaxSize style data is used for table flex items
Bug 1692607 N[Core:Layout: Tables]Empty columns doesn't apply CSS border-spacing (cellspacing)
Bug 1692734 R[Core:Networking: DNS]Long page loads with DoH enabled
Bug 1689987 R[Core:Networking: DNS]Add some probes for ODoH
Bug 1692886 R[Core:Networking: HTTP]Telemetry::HTTP_TRANSACTION_RESTART_REASON is not recorded properly
Bug 1691878 R[Core:Panning and Zooming]modify gfx/layers/apz/test/mochitest/helper_scrollframe_activation_on_load.html and test_layerization.html so they better test the activate all scroll frames code better
Bug 1689271 R[Core:Privacy: Anti-Tracking]Remove or update probes expiring in Firefox 88: COOKIE_PURGING_*
Bug 1511151 R[Core:Security: PSM]Add a preference to enable sending client certificates when Fetch's credentials mode would exclude them, even though the spec says not to
Bug 1692385 R[Core:WebRTC: Audio/Video]GetSinkDevice() leaks SourceListeners until the window is navigated
Bug 1693346 R[Core:Widget]Test failure in layout/reftests/forms/input/range/auto-size.html with NNT
Bug 1693426 R[Core:Widget]Add support for vertical progress bars and meters in non-native theme
Bug 1693587 R[Core:Widget]Remove nsWindow::DispatchPluginEvent
Bug 1693592 R[Core:Widget: Android]checkbox-clamp-02.html now passes on Android with the new non-native theme
Bug 1693466 R[Core:Widget: Cocoa]Mark radio-minimum-size.html as expected pass on macOS when the non-native theme is enabled
Bug 1693696 R[Core:Widget: Cocoa]Inconsistent arrow panel shadows
Bug 1693697 R[Core:Widget: Cocoa]Stop calling CGSSetWindowBackgroundBlurRadius
Bug 1693434 R[Core:Widget: Cocoa]Report uncaught Objective C exceptions via crash reports
Bug 1691141 R[Core:Widget: Cocoa]backplate-bg-image-008.html unexpectedly fails on macOS with non-native theme turned on
Bug 1691148 R[Core:Widget: Cocoa]checkbox-clamp-01.html and radio-clamp-01.html fail on macOS and Windows due to new minimum widget size in non-native theme
Bug 1693471 R[Core:Widget: Cocoa]Adjust fuzzines for anonymous-block.html on macOS (and Android) with non-native theme enabled
Bug 1693623 R[Core:Widget: Win32]Adjust fuzziness on some reftests on Windows when the non-native theme is enabled
Bug 1686616 R[Core:XPCOM]Migrate all Services.py interfaces to components.conf
Bug 1689257 R[Core:XPConnect]Remove or update probes expiring in Firefox 88: STARTUP_CACHE_REQUESTS
Bug 1693027 R[Core:XPConnect]ScriptPreloader discards correctly decoded script incorrectly.
Bug 1693658 R[Core:XUL]Add a comment to nsXULElement::Construct.
Bug 1692965 R[DevTools:Framework]Remove the ChromeWindowTargetActor
Bug 1692874 R[DevTools:Framework]Use descriptors instead of current top level target to create Toolbox and TargetList
Bug 1693144 R[DevTools:Framework]Intermittent devtools/client/framework/test/browser_toolbox_options_disable_js.js | targetList.isJavascriptEnabled is correct before the toggle - Got true, expected false
Bug 1691608 R[DevTools:Inspector]Fix and re-enable devtools/client/inspector/test/browser_inspector_open_on_neterror.js test for Fission
Bug 1691607 R[DevTools:Inspector]Fix and re-enable devtools/client/inspector/test/browser_inspector_navigate_to_errors.js test for Fission
Bug 1693498 R[External Software Affecting Firefox:OpenH264]Build openh264 with nasm on all platforms that need nasm or yasm
Bug 1571419 N[Firefox:Headless]Make firefox --screenshot Fission compatible
Bug 1693406 R[Firefox:Menus][Proton] Content select dropdowns show black boxes around them in dark mode
Bug 1689567 R[Firefox:Messaging System]Add telemetry and handle "disconnected" events for infobar_message
Bug 1693437 R[Firefox:Messaging System]Intermittent toolkit/components/messaging-system/test/browser/browser_remotesettingsexperimentloader_init.js | false == true - JS frame :: chrome://mochitests/content/browser/toolkit/components/messaging-system/test/browser/browser_remotesettingsexperimen
Bug 1692227 R[Firefox:Nimbus Desktop Client]Add ExperimentFeature to newnewtab/settings panel
Bug 1474397 R[Firefox:Normandy Client]Show Normandy information in about:support
Bug 1693527 R[Firefox:Security]When migrating old TRR mode, don't clear network.trr.mode if its value is 5.
Bug 1689258 R[Firefox:Tabbed Browser]Remove or update probes expiring in Firefox 88: FX_TAB_SWITCH_SPINNER_VISIBLE_*
Bug 1692351 R[Firefox:Toolbars and Customization]Can't start new profile with browser.proton.toolbar.enabled on
Bug 1692555 R[Firefox:Toolbars and Customization]Update focus outline offset to not visually increase toolbar button size.
Bug 1692943 R[Firefox Build System:General]ModuleNotFoundError: No module named 'zstandard' with --enable-bootstrap on mac
Bug 1692939 R[Firefox Build System:General]Misc small improvements to the python configure sandbox/linter
Bug 1693275 R[Firefox Build System:General]Drop MOZ_LOW_PARALLELISM_BUILD for builds that are no longer using GCC
Bug 1692611 R[Firefox Build System:Mach Core]Tab completion gives 'No handlers could be found for logger "moz.configure.reduced"'
Bug 1602143 R[Firefox Build System:Source Code Analysis]Make clang-tidy readability-braces-around-statements less verbose
Bug 1693479 R[Firefox Build System:Task Configuration]Switch linux64-aarch64 build to using a sysroot
Bug 1689562 A[Thunderbird:Upstream Synchronization]thunderbird perma fail after bug 1667276 | toolkit/components/backgroundtasks/tests/xpcshell/test_backgroundtask_specific_pref.js, toolkit/components/backgroundtasks/tests/xpcshell/test_backgroundtask_policies.js, test_crash_backgroundtask_moz_crash.js
Bug 1693642 R[Toolkit:Add-ons Manager]Vertically align the radio buttons' text on about:addons details panel
Bug 1672431 A[Toolkit:Async Tooling]Update AsyncShutdown blockers to allow IO until the end of the before profile change phase
Bug 1669732 R[Toolkit:Printing]Add error message for page copies
Bug 1692301 R[Toolkit:Themes]Add dark mode support for about:buildconfig
Bug 1679174 R[Toolkit:Video/Audio Controls][PiP] The Ctrl + Shift + ] keyboard shortcut tries to open PiP on <video> with a NaN duration
###########
Changes to 66 bugs - 59 fixed.
6 bugs are not included due to being restricted